What's up, everyone? All right. So, this
morning was really tricky. We had a
number of round trips. We had stocks
that popped up on breaking news, came
all the way back down in spite of the
news, which is I mean
it's not totally unusual. This does
happen. It's kind of a symptom of two
things. Number one, attention right now
has been focused on Chinese stocks with
no news. And so, a stock with news is
kind of being disregarded because it's
not Chinese and it has news, right? So,
that feels backwards. And some of these
headlines read well. It seemed like
these are good catalysts. I'm stepping
up to the plate, and then I'm shocked
that we're not getting this continuation
and follow-through. So, on the one hand,
we are getting a little bit of volume
because, yeah, it's it's a news
headline. It's a good headline. The
stock pops up. But then, it's quickly
flushing. And I think that short sellers
are being aggressive shorting things
that are outside of the theme, which is
no news Chinese stocks. So, they're not
touching the no news Chinese stocks cuz
they're getting wrecked on those. But
they are trading to the short side of
sort of everything else that's a
distraction. The problem with that is
that what happens when you short a stock
that comes out with news, and the news
is so good that other traders really do
start to pick up on it, and the stock
becomes the leading gainer and is the
next one to go up 3 4 500%? Well, you
have a short squeeze. But that didn't
happen today. It's Friday. It's the end
of the week, and clearly the sentiment
was weaker. So, let's go ahead and jump

I like thinkorswim. I like it for the
small account challenge. I I've used
I've traded it. I mean, you guys have
watched me trade do a number of
challenges in it
and use it for my big accounts as well.
And my issue with thinkorswim is that
when the market is hot, you can get
great fills and you can do really well
and you can make a lot of money. And
when the market is cold, I find that I
get really bad fills. I got a lot more
slippage. I can't get in and out. And so
in my Lightspeed account, I can be much
more nimble. I can jump in, I can jump
out, book the profit. But in the
thinkorswim accounts, I just feel like
the issue has always been that when the
market's hot, yeah, I can get in and
out, but I feel like it's a little
sloppy. Like my it's not precise. It's
kind of like, you know, carving a
I don't know, a steak or a turkey with a
butter knife. Like it works. Maybe
that's not the best example, but you
know, it it it works, but
in in areas where you need to be
precise, it it just doesn't quite keep
up. And so today was the day where it it
